Four Ways MySQL Executes GROUP BY

In this blog post, I’ll look into four ways MySQL executes GROUP BY. 

In my previous blog post, we learned that indexes or other means of finding data might not be the most expensive part of query execution. For example, MySQL GROUP BY could potentially be responsible for 90% or more of the query execution time. 

The main complexity when MySQL executes GROUP BY is computing aggregate functions in a GROUP BY statement. How this works is shown in the documentation for UDF Aggregate Functions. As we see, the requirement is that UDF functions get all values that constitute the single group one …

Updating/Deleting Rows with ClickHouse (Part 1)

In this post, we’ll look at updating and deleting rows with ClickHouse. It’s the first of two parts.

Update: Part 2 of this post is here.

ClickHouse is fast – blazing fast! It’s quite easy to pick up, and with ProxySQL integrating with existing applications already using MySQL, it’s way less complex than using other analytics options. However, ClickHouse does not support UPDATE/DELETE (yet). That entry barrier can easily dissuade potential users despite the good things I mentioned.

If there is a will, there is a way! We have so far taken advantage of the new feature that supports more granular partitioning strategy (by week, by day or something else). With more …

Using ioping to Evaluate Storage Performance for MySQL Workloads

In this blog post, we’ll look at how ioping can be used with other tools to understand and troubleshoot storage performance, specifically as it relates to MySQL workloads.

I recently ran into ioping, a nice little utility by Konstantin Khlebnikov that checks storage latency.  

For me, the main beauty of ioping is its simplicity and familiarity. It takes after the ubiquitous ping tool, but “pings” the storage instead of the network device.

First, let’s talk about what this tool isn’t: it isn’t a benchmark tool to stress load your storage as heavily as possible. For that, you can use iozone or sysbench (among many others). This also isn’t a tool for looking at …

Common Table Expressions (CTEs) Part 1

Occasionally at conference or a Meetup, someone will approach me and ask me for help with a MySQL problem.  Eight out of ten times their difficulty includes a sub query. "I get an error message about a corrugated or conflabugated sub query or some such,"  they say, desperate for help.  Usually with a bit of fumbling we can get their problem solved.  The problem is not a lack of knowledge for either of us but that sub queries are often hard to write. 

MySQL 8 will be the first version of the most popular database on the web with Common Table Expressions or CTEs.  CTEs are a way to create temporary tables and then use that temporary table for queries. Think of them as easy to write sub queries!
